On 05/09/2012 11:06 PM, mephysto wrote: > Hi there, > I'm using postgres-JDBC ina GlassFish application server to develop a web > service application. I made several tries with either XA and standard > driver. I use JDBC connection pool of GlassFish. > I found that transaction started into a web service operation, are closed at > the end of operation, not when in the code the connection are closed. > > I am searching a solution to close transaction that permit me to close > trasaction when I want it, before end of web service operation. > > Is there a way to achieve this goal? If you're using XA transactions in a Java EE context, what you want is probably an EJB3 with @TransactionAttribute(TransactionAttributeType.REQUIRES_NEW) which will force the EJB business method(s) so annotated to run in their own independent transactions. Note that these transactions will *NOT* be able to see any uncommitted changes from your main transaction, they're completely independent and behind the scenes with PostgreSQL are actually new connections to the server. -- Craig Ringer
